The Eastern Florida State College women's basketball team is in Lubbock, Texas preparing for the NJCAA Division I National Championship Tournament.

The Titans come into the tournament as the No. 2 seed in the tournament and will face the winner of No. 15 Casper and No. 18 Walters State College on Thursday at 7 p.m. EDT. Casper is 30-3 this season and has won 17 in a row. Casper won the Northwest Plains title and will face Walters State College is 25-4 overall and won the Appalachian District to make the tournament.

Casper and Walters State will tip off Wednesday at 3 p.m. EDT in a first-round matchup in the 24-team field set to play at Rip Griffin Center at Lubbock Christian University in Lubbock, Texas.

Eastern Florida State College comes into the national tournament as one of the best defensive teams in the country, holding opponents to 48.8 points per game which is fifth in the nation.
